Advantage India has achieved in software outsourcing is not overnight. Offshore Outsourcing has grown and matured with time. In 90's, companies like GE, Citibank and British Airways started outsourcing to India and till then it has gone through many phases to compete with the best. After Initial phase, companies like Nortel and Lucent started to outsource product development to speed it up and market faster. During this time, Indian majors like Wipro and Infosys also started. In the second phase Y2K bug gave lot of work to Indian companies and gave them enough finance to grow. And with that, they started in service provider section as well as in enterprise application development. Next wave was of BPO Industry which is till going on and supply is not meeting the demand. And along with these, software outsourcing is increasing continuously. According to McKinsey, software outsourcing will increase 30-40% every year for next five years. According to Forrester research, around 3.3 million white collar jobs will be outsourced by 2015. And according to Deloitte research, two million financial sector jobs will be outsourced by 2009. And major chunk of this software outsourcing and other jobs are coming to India. Offshore outsourcing in Europe

Now global slowdown has gone from the screens of Indian offshore outsourcing companies. The days are back where supply is unable to meet the demands and margins are getting better and better. Again time is back, where offshore outsourcing companies are not able to hire enough despite the high bench strength. High margin in business is justifying bench strength which can be deployed on demand.

Change in the global scenario

Negative effect of weaker American economy on the wake of 9/11 terrorist attack is now diminished. Companies are putting new plans for their technology improvement or buying. But majority companies are going for cost cutting where offshore outsourcing becomes a very attractive option for them. Because of higher competition, companies are now being forced to look at offshore software development centers as a strategic step. Now, when price market has gone down, Indian software outsourcing companies are becoming very attractive with their cost effective outsourcing solutions for US customers. But scenario in Europe is different then this. Majority of India’s software export is to US and majority of 'outsourcing to India' companies are looking at US, Europe accounts for a very small percentage of software export.

Why offshore outsourcing in Europe doesn’t have significant presence like in US?

Popular perception is that, in Europe, Indian companies are facing language problem in offshore outsourcing. But it is not the fact. Language is not the big problem. But the fascination of US market where it is relatively easy to get project and do body shopping business to make quick money has made Indian outsourcing companies to concentrate more on US market. Unlike Europe, in US it is easy to do body shopping or even subcontracting software project development, application development or web development. Once project is got, company tries to close it as soon as possible and hunt for another project.

However, market in Europe is totally different then US for offshore outsourcing companies. Companies in Europe look for longer term fruitful relationship. While Indian companies go with a look of 'body shopper'. Which don’t suit European market. Indian outsourcing companies have to show customer what they offer more to them can compare to customer's current supplier and then wait for customer to understand his benefits. Because of this, Indian offshore outsourcing companies need to change their attitude. European software market is of $3 trillion and Indian companies have very small stack in it. To get a foot in European market, Indian companies require providing high quality delivery in time and within budget. Along with that, they need to have a strong sales force who understand European culture and European market and can take benefit in offshore outsourcing.

Indian software outsourcing companies battle to retain staff

Problems faced by software outsourcing companies


Software Outsourcing Indian companies are facing growing challenge of maintaining the employees, although they hire tens of thousands every year. Many companies are seeing half of their software programming staff getting replaced in a year. Almost all companies are facing this as their major problem. For software outsourcing Indian companies, staff costs over 50% of the total cost and this high attrition rate is leading to higher rise in employee salaries.

Damage because of staff attrition in software outsourcing


But real damage is not just the cost of lost staff but lost business for companies because when key employees leave, they take knowledge with them of existing development. Because of that, it becomes difficult to complete project intimae and in budget. Which can also lead to loss of business? Because of this, demand of quality programmers for offshore software development is outstripping supply.

Solution for software outsourcing companies


Many companies are providing free transport, subsidized meals, housing and entertaining environment to their employees. But this is not proving to be enough. This high attrition rate is proving to be obstacle and limiting growth of many companies. Because pool of good software programmers is very limited. Because of this, many companies around Bangalore, Bombay or Delhi are trying to fan out to other cities where expectations are lower because of less opportunities.

Software outsourcing and its future

A report by research and consulting firm Forrester Research mentions that, jobs which are lost in United states because of software outsourcing are primarily low salary IT jobs. These jobs are like software programming or computer support specialists or computer operators. But on the other hand, high end high paying jobs like system analysts, network analysts and research analysts have seen continuous and stronger growth. Jobs in this niche market is growing steadily at the rate of 4 to 5% every year. These jobs which require stronger domain knowledge and knowledge of internal working of IT systems and business process are difficult to software outsource.

Which jobs will not get affected by software outsourcing


Jobs for software engineers for the position of system analysis and application implementation are also growing at the rate of 6% a year. This is because, though software outsourcing can be done to India or other offshore software development locations, customers require in-house staff for customization and maintenance of purchased software.


Why Software outsourcing will decrease


Report also mention that, attraction of cost saving in software outsourcing is yet very high and because of that, increase in jobs like software programmer will be very minimal. Also, because of very low increase in software programming jobs, salary rise will also hardly 1% in next few years. Salary of computer operators and database administrators will also grow at barely 1% rate. On the other hand, report also mentions about jobs which will have highest salary rise. Salaries of computer research scientists and information system managers will have highest growth which will be around 3.5% every year. While salaries of analysts and system administrators will grow at the rate of 2 to 3% every year.


Conclusion about offshore software development


Report concludes with note that software outsourcing which has major costs saving today will decrease by 2008. Because in US salary rise will be very less. While in India and other offshore software development destination, because of lack of availability of resources, salary rise will be very high. This will decrease the difference between salary of Indian and US software engineer and eventually decrease costs saving. So many companies will prefer in-house resources rather then software outsourcing.
